Sunderland star confident ahead of Chelsea clash

The Black Cats won 3-0 at Stamford Bridge last season.

“Some people will be writing us off already – but we’ve got results before and we can do it again,” he told the club’s official website.

“We are all looking forward to the game, which should be a fantastic occasion. As a player, I treat every game the same, though.”

He added: “I’m playing the game that I love and my approach doesn’t change no matter who we’re playing.

“Chelsea are a challenge to play against as a defender because they have some great striking talent, but I play the game to test myself against the world’s best.

“Obviously they have some great attacking players and they will be a threat no matter who is on the pitch on the day.”
